bridge tie
Railways; Railroad
A sawed tie usually preframed and of the size and length required for track on a bridge. Usually hardwood.
bridge, deck span
Railways; Railroad
A bridge in which the track is carried on top of the stringers (girders) or trusses.

bridge, girder
Railways; Railroad
A bridge in which the track is supported on the top of (deck girder) or between two or more steel plate girders (trough girder), normally used on spans of 30 to 120 feet.
